  • I would have never guessed that Phoenix was such a pricey city for hotels. The Clarendon was on the lower side of the cost scale and with free parking I was sold on it. Once we arrived I was pleasantly surprised at how cute the hotel was. The front desk staff was great, helpful and always very friendly regardless of time of day. I loved the fact that at night you were able to get some free snacks and soda. Forgot suntan lotion, no problem, you can borrow some of theirs. We had booked a Jr. Suite, but upon checking in were upgraded to a 1 bedroom suite. We headed up to room 308, which was on the end, so it was a good location. The room was spacious and decorated with a modern trendy type flair. The bed was extremely comfortable. The air conditioning units...the one in the bedroom was fine. The one in the living room made an annoying noise every now and again. Unfortunately if we shut it off the bedroom just got too hot, so we lived with the noise. It wasn't constant so it wasn't so bad. The rooms contain bottles of water, that you don't have to pay for as well as a mini refrigerator. Big pluses in my book. The bathroom is a little small and could use a bit of an update but it was fine. The only issue we had was that our room wasn't cleaned 1 day. After being out all morning we returned about 3pm to find our room had not been touched. We asked the front desk and were told they were still cleaning, so we headed for the pool for a couple of hours only to return again with the room not being cleaned. The next morning our room was cleaned while we were at breakfast. Not sure what happened, but it wasn't anything to get real upset about. You pay an additional $15/night for use of pool and wifi, etc. The pool is great as is the large whirlpool. Gallo Blanco located in the lobby is delicious as I mentioned my review for that. The rooftop was a nice place to sit an watch the sunset or enjoy a drink at night. Pay attention to their recommended restaurants in the area and trust them. We tried 2 (Tuck Shop and Local Breeze) and they were both fabulous. All in all, I thought the hotel was great and would definitely stay there again.
